Current research interests
i) Novel phenomena in optical microcavities and cavity-quantum electrodynamics (cQED) systems.
ii). On-chip integrated multi-functional photonic devices for future lab-on-a-chip applications.
(e.g., label-free biosensing, optical manipulation, surface-enhanced Raman scattering analysis).
iii). Micro and nanofabrication technologies for the development of silicon photonics and optofluidics
